WHITTINGHAM v. VILLAGE OF DOWNERS GROVE

Gen. No. 68-42.

101 Ill. App.2d 166 (1968)

242 N.E.2d 460

William F. Whittingham and Marie Whittingham, His Wife, Plaintiffs and Appellees, v. Village of Downers Grove, Defendant and Appellant.

Appellate Court of Illinois — Second Judicial District.

November 21, 1968.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Raymond S. Osheroff, Schiff, Hardin, Waite, Dorschel and Britton, of Chicago, and Gordon C. Bunge, of Downers Grove, for appellant.

Hooper, Bowers, Calkins & Carney, of Downers Grove, for appellees.


MR. JUSTICE DAVIS delivered the opinion of the court.

The plaintiffs brought this suit to have the defendant's zoning ordinance declared invalid as applied to their property. The trial court, in a bench trial, entered judgment for the plaintiffs, from which the defendant appealed.

In support of their case, the plaintiffs offered two expert witnesses, in addition to the testimony of one of the plaintiffs. The defendant offered no evidence, other than one exhibit...
